Using BIOS
IDE HDD Block Mode (Enabled)
Enable this field if your IDE hard drive supports block mode. Block mode enables BIOS to
automatically detect the optimal number of block read and writes per sector that the drive
can support and improves the speed of access to IDE devices.

MC97 Modem (Auto)
Enables and disables the onboard modem. Disable this item if you are going to install an
external modem.
OnBoard Lan (Enabled)
Enables and disables the onboard LAN.
Onboard Lan Boot ROM (Disabled)
This item allows you to enable or disable the onboard LAN boot ROM function.
OnChip USB Controller (All Enabled)
Enable this item if you plan to use the Universal Serial Bus ports on this motherboard.
USB 2.0 Supports (Enabled)
Enable this item if your system supports USB 2.0
USB Legacy Support (Enabled)
This item allows the BIOS to interact with a USB keyboard or mouse to work with MS-DOS
based utilities and non-Windows modes.
AC97 Audio( Auto)
Enables and disables the onboard audio chip. Disable this item if you are going to install a
PCI audio add-in card.
